The photo on the top was shot on top of an iron train bridge looking immediately down (Border line hanging off the side). I thought it would be a great black and white - I like how the composition strikes you as odd. It takes a couple seconds to piece together what it is. I think the attractive element or rather "eye candy" of this photo is the smoothness of the River caused by a long shutter exposure.

The photo below is of the inside of a tree log. Their is so much moisture around waterfalls that it creates a climate of super green plants and fungus - I like the perspective and depth of field in this photos. The dark's are rich and adds mood to the first impression. So much fun :)
